Primary Focus

Getty Images targets major brands and publishers; Vexels serves Print on Demand sellers.

Tie

Getty Images focuses on exclusive creative assets and comprehensive editorial content. Global news, sports, and fashion are covered instantly. Content aims for maximum impact worldwide. Vexels is built solely for Print on Demand entrepreneurs needing high-volume, ready-to-sell assets. It supports platforms like Amazon Merch and Etsy directly. Getty Images offers prestige and depth, but Vexels offers utility and speed for merchandise creation. Decide whether you need premium stock or mass-production tools. If you are running an e-commerce hustle, Vexels is the purpose-built tool.

Asset Uniqueness

Getty Images guarantees assets you won't find anywhere; Vexels provides high-volume, editable templates.

Getty Images

Getty Images offers millions of exclusive photos, vectors, and video content. You get access to the world's largest digital archive and unique editorial content. This content is high-end and often scarce. Vexels provides over 500,000 POD Design Templates ready for commercial use. Assets are designed specifically to be edited and sold quickly on merchandise. Getty Images excels in exclusivity and high-resolution quality for major brands. Vexels prioritizes editability and volume specific to POD needs. If brand exclusivity is your top priority, you won't beat the selection offered by Getty Images.

Pricing Model

Vexels uses cheap subscriptions; Getty Images relies on expensive, per-download credit packs.

Vexels

Getty Images costs are extremely high, ranging from $130 up to $499 per single download. This uses UltraPacks, which target deep pockets and high-budget projects. Vexels offers monthly subscriptions starting around $10.50 (annual billing). This provides dozens of downloads and hundreds of AI credits monthly for steady volume. Getty Images' high price buys exclusive prestige for your projects. Vexels' low price buys the volume and tools necessary for mass production. Vexels is the clear budget winner, offering significantly more resources for a fraction of the cost per month.

Generative AI

Both have AI; Getty Images ensures commercial safety, and Vexels specializes in apparel design.

Tie

Getty Images' Generative AI creates commercially safe, ready-to-license images from text prompts. It also lets users modify existing creative images within the library. Vexels' AI is optimized specifically for generating printable merch and high-quality T-shirt designs. Users can access over 20 new AI styles instantly. Getty Images provides broad commercial protection and advanced AI modification options. Vexels provides tailored design speed for POD sellers. The choice depends on needing general-purpose protected AI (Getty Images) or specialized merch creation AI (Vexels).

Creative Tools

Vexels provides crucial online editing and mockup tools; Getty Images only provides the premium assets.

Vexels

Getty Images is fundamentally a content library and relies on external professional software for editing. Its only internal tool is AI modification. Vexels includes the T-Shirt Design Maker and the Mockup Generator right in the platform. These let you personalize templates and create realistic product previews instantly. Vexels is an all-in-one creation tool for merchandise professionals. Getty Images is strictly a premium content provider. If you want to edit and customize assets immediately online, Vexels is the only option here.

Video & Multimedia

Getty Images offers extensive 4K/HD video and music; Vexels focuses strictly on 2D graphics.

Getty Images

Getty Images offers millions of 4K and HD video clips and a music library. This is a comprehensive media solution for high-end production needs. Vexels does not offer video or dedicated audio libraries for commercial production. It is focused solely on graphics, vectors, and templates. If your content strategy requires high-resolution moving media, Vexels cannot compete. Getty Images is the leader in premium video content. Only Getty Images provides the full range of multimedia assets necessary for film, broadcast, and high-quality digital ads.

Digital Asset Management

Getty Images features a robust DAM system; Vexels focuses on asset creation, not complex management.

Getty Images

Getty Images uses the powerful Media Manager system for enterprise needs. This tool is for organizing, controlling, and distributing licensed digital assets efficiently. Vexels focuses purely on providing fast paths to export graphics for POD platforms. Management features for enterprise teams are not mentioned. For large organizations that need centralized control over global licenses, Media Manager is required. Vexels lacks this capability entirely. The DAM system gives Getty Images a huge advantage for corporations and massive content buyers.

Frequently Asked Questions

Which is better for high-volume daily downloads: Getty Images or Vexels?

Vexels is far better for high volume needs because its subscription model is affordable. Vexels plans provide many downloads and credits monthly, starting around $10.50. Getty Images assets cost hundreds of dollars each in comparison.

Does Getty Images offer the creative editing tools that Vexels includes?

No. Vexels includes specialized tools like the T-Shirt Design Maker and Mockup Generator. Getty Images is strictly a premium content library that requires external graphic software for editing. Its AI only provides basic modification capabilities.

Are Getty Images' assets or Vexels' templates more expensive?

Getty Images assets are significantly more expensive, costing up to $499 for a single download. Vexels operates on a subscription model where individual assets are included in the low monthly fee. Vexels provides superior value for money.

Which platform provides better resources for editorial or news content?

Getty Images is the undisputed winner for editorial and news content. They provide comprehensive, up-to-the-minute global coverage and the world's largest digital archive. Vexels does not offer any editorial imagery.

Which has safer billing practices: Getty Images or Vexels?

Vexels has a much higher customer trust rating (3.8 stars) than Getty Images (1.3 stars). Users widely report that Getty Images has rampant problems with unauthorized charges and unresponsive support regarding billing issues. Vexels is the safer choice.

Can I use Generative AI on both Getty Images and Vexels?

Yes, both offer powerful AI tools. Getty Images features commercially safe content generation and image modification. Vexels offers specialized AI designed specifically for creating printable merchandise designs.
